File Approval Management System (FAMS) assists decision makers with easy, fast and intelligent document storage-retrieval to make informed decisions and maintain edge in competitive business. It also helps convert totally paper dependent organization to minimal paper user. Business-critical documents are preserved for years and available at fingertips with highly responsive search features.
Server: PIII, 256MB RAM, WIN 2000, MSMQ, IIS
Client: Win 9x, Win 2K, Internet Explorer
